The United States is a continent. A route that looks compact on a map can involve twelve-hour driving days, and underestimating distance is the most common planning mistake.

Choose a realistic route

Pick one region and go deep rather than crossing the country in a fortnight. The Southwest, the Pacific Coast, the Blue Ridge, and the Great Lakes each support a full two-week trip.

  • Pacific Coast Highway — coastal California and Oregon
  • Southwest loop — Utah and Arizona parks
  • Blue Ridge Parkway — Virginia and North Carolina
  • Great Lakes circuit — Michigan and Wisconsin shorelines

Book what sells out

In-park lodging, campgrounds, and timed-entry permits open on fixed schedules and disappear within minutes at popular parks. Set calendar reminders for release dates.
